Transaction fa4149f414383e67ff319593cc591e89ad79e2fffd6eb513024d7404b827e408

1 Input
2 Outputs
  • fa4149f414383e67ff319593cc591e89ad79e2fffd6eb513024d7404b827e408:0
  • value  15554274
    address  3Q5xeSfYh9qPWQspKiPnQQdgdNRTBJKXaG
  • fa4149f414383e67ff319593cc591e89ad79e2fffd6eb513024d7404b827e408:1
  • value  475000
    address  3CTYsctMrVhw3abYHUDdN7jxDLw25CD96F